Text: Means of information in Madagascar

In Madagascar, we mainly have three means of information: newspapers, radios and televisions.

Newspapers are read by a lot of people in town. Articles and their illustrations are generally interesting. Besides, newspapers may be bought by everyone because they are not expensive. Unfortunately, neither daily nor weekly papers can reach all people especially those who live far from city.

Radio is also another efficient means of information. It does not cost a lot so it is the most used mass media in Madagascar. Every home, even in remote areas, may have a radio set. All kinds of information such as weather forecasts, news as well as music are broadcast.

Another type of mass media is television. However, it seems to be only reserved for city dwellers until now. This is because there is no electricity in the countryside and it is rather costly for majority of the population.

As a conclusion, the development of means of information contributes to the development of a country so the government should find a way to make the Malagasy people have easier access to information.
